What should I look for when choosing an optometrist in a smaller community like Strattanville?

In a smaller community, it's important to consider the optometrist's range of services and their network. Look for a practice that offers comprehensive eye exams, manages ocular diseases, and has a good selection of frames, as you may have fewer immediate alternatives. Check if they have strong relationships with local ophthalmologists in Clarion or Erie for referrals if specialized care is needed. Also, consider their office hours and flexibility, as practices in rural areas may have more limited schedules. Reading local reviews or asking neighbors for personal experiences can be very valuable.

Do optometrists near Strattanville accept my vision or medical insurance?

Insurance acceptance varies. Most optometry practices in the Clarion County area, including those serving Strattanville residents, typically accept major medical insurance (like Highmark, UPMC) for health-related eye care and Medicare. For vision-specific plans (like VSP or EyeMed), it's best to call the practice directly to verify participation, as provider networks can change. Be sure to have your insurance card ready when calling to schedule an appointment at a local or nearby clinic to confirm coverage details specific to your plan.

How far in advance do I need to book an appointment with an optometrist near Strattanville, PA?

Appointment lead times can vary. For a routine eye exam, it's common to schedule 2 to 6 weeks in advance, especially for popular times like after-school hours or Saturdays. For more urgent concerns (like sudden vision changes or eye injuries), most practices in the region will work to accommodate you sooner, often within 24-48 hours. Due to the smaller number of providers in the immediate area, planning ahead for routine care is recommended. Many practices now offer online scheduling, which can be convenient for residents in Strattanville and the surrounding rural areas.
